Dimond care: Lotions, powders, soaps and your body’s natural oils can add a film to diamonds. To restore the radiance of your natural or lab-grown diamonds, soak in warm water and mild detergent-free soap. Gently scrub with a soft-bristled or baby-sized toothbrush to dislodge any dirt from the facets.

Opal care: Prevent exposing your opal jewellery to prolonged contact with water, liquids, or chemicals. Temporary transparency may occur if an opal absorbs water, while exposure to chemicals could result in lasting changes.
Should your opal get wet, gently pat it dry using a soft, clean cloth. As it dries, the original colour should gradually return.
Store your opal jewellery in a dry environment, keeping it away from direct sunlight and extreme temperature shifts.
Solid gold jewellery (9K, 14K & 18K) is durable and designed for everyday wear, but still benefits from mindful care to preserve its shine.
• Avoid contact with harsh chemicals, perfumes, and cleaning products
• Remove during strenuous activity to prevent scratches or knocks
• Store each piece separately in a cool, dry place to avoid tangling or damage
• Soak briefly in warm water with mild detergent
• Gently scrub with a soft-bristled or baby toothbrush to remove dirt
• Pat dry with a cotton or microfibre cloth (avoid tissues or paper towel)
• Polish with the cloth provided to restore radiance and lustre
